Default Throttle Bodies and intake manifolds for em2?

Does anyone know if there are any throttle bodies or intake manifolds out for the d17a2 (04 civic ex coupe)? I have seen something like a universal skunk2 throttle body? How exactly will that work and would there need to be any modifications? Also, i have seen an intake manifold by venom on hopupracing.com. It says for sohc civics. Would that fit like it was made for a d17a2 or would there have to be any modifications?

Default

For the price......I think your better off buying a cheap y8 manifold and jsut making that fit. The KMS is decently priced and you can prolly pick up a full y8 mani for around 50 bucks then just find someone that can weld the new flang and you;ll have to fool with the vaccum lines and what not. Your prolly not going to see a huge diff between the y8 and kms
